A Slow, Saucy & Sacred Invitation
This 4-day experience will be a deep dive into the magic and intimacy of Micro Dance, where we can saucily play in the slow burn and restorative nourishment of profound presence.
This experience is a brave space to lean into any edge that dancing with others may present, while being given space to gently broaden your comfort zone.
Preliminary Schedule
Day 1: Container Setting – Creating a Magical Container: Structure and Connection – Ecstatic Dance
Day 2: Embodying Invitation: Consent & Attunement – Connection Technique: Rhythm & Groove – Shaping Space with Awareness and Physics – Social Dance curated by Wren
Day 3: Musicality: Listening with your Whole Body – Softening into Surrender: Dips and Deepening Trust – Leading from Humility: Invitation and Following First – CommuniYum Dance
Day 4: Microcosmic Majesty: Sublime Subtlety in Somatic Conversation – From Lost in the Sauce to Found in the Flow: Accessing The Inner Dance – Final Sacred Sauce Dance

Join us at SoulPlay’s first festival weekend where you’ll get to experience Cocréa sharing Mindful Partner Dance FUNdamentals based in Blues Fusion technique, contact and theater improvisation concepts and relational alchemy intelligence.
Cocréa is a meeting place in practice for those seekers on the longest pathway from the head to the heart through the body.
Welcome to the dance floor of life.
Wren LaFeet
Facilitator • Cocréa Director and Co-Founder
Wren is celebrating the exquisite privilege of getting to dance in partnership for almost 25 years and loves serving humanity as a somatic permissionary. Teaching partner dance internationally as a practice for mindful, authentic living, and enlivening communities by facilitating his signature modality, Cocréa, has been his joy for over a decade. Wren guides humans curious about embodiment towards right relationship by exploring the realms of Self, Earth, Music, Sacred Other, Community and Whole through listening and responding, and inviting, allowing and embracing change. He is a celebrated TEDx speaker, featured author in “ReInhabiting the Village” and ardent proponent of pioneering a new renaissance through authentic connection and consensual touch.
